You're probably considering about whether those appealing green peas on your plate are safe for your furry friend. The good news is that, in reasonable quantities, green peas can be a nutritious treat for dogs. They're low in calories read more and packed with vitamins like vitamin C and potassium, which are great for their overall health. However, it's important to remember that too many peas can cause digestive issues. Always give new foods gradually and observe your dog for any adverse symptoms. If you have any concerns, it's best to speak with your veterinarian.
